Output 91ede5a3c68d1eb546065457d04cf8e9249eaf43f506f0c3b412b0cb0978b086:42

value
12051705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94c3a499e5f902c11b1a9639ee9ae6b074ba750 OP_EQUAL
address
3L3P4VcWghkkDCyFxeF2q19xwnZZhyh8JV
transaction
91ede5a3c68d1eb546065457d04cf8e9249eaf43f506f0c3b412b0cb0978b086
spent
true